Verizon Denies Text Fee Hike

Verizon Wireless said today that contrary to reports last week, it has not decided to increase per-message text fees for content aggregators from 1 cent per message to 3 cents.

The prospect of an increase is just one proposal and Verizon could not act unilaterally to implement it, a company spokesman explained this morning.

Initial reports last week cited a letter from Verizon to aggregators in which the wireless operator said the increase is effective Nov. 1.

That was a misstatement, the nation’s second-largest wireless operator said today. Verizon would be the largest carrier if its proposed $5.9 billion acquisition of Alltel is approved by the government.

The company declined to say if other proposals are being considered, if there’s a timeframe for reaching a decision about any change, or how the miscommunication happened.

Concern throughout the industry is that if fees are increased, then many small companies would be adversely affected and that charges could be passed on to consumers.
